Ingredients Needed

To make these tasty Oreo Brownie Cookie Bars, you will need:

  • For the Brownie Layer:

    • 1 box of brownie mix (plus the ingredients listed on the box)
  • For the Cookie Layer:

    • 1 cup of chocolate chip cookie dough (store-bought or homemade)
  • For the Oreo Layer:

    • 15 Oreo cookies
  • Optional Topping:

    • 1/2 cup chocolate chips (for extra indulgence)

How to Make Oreo Brownie Cookie Bars

  1. Preheat and Prepare: Begin by preheating your oven according to the brownie mix instructions. Grease a baking pan to prevent sticking.

  2. Mix the Brownie Batter: Prepare the brownie mix according to the package instructions. Pour half of the brownie batter into the greased pan, spreading it evenly.

  3. Add the Oreos: Take the Oreo cookies and lay them evenly over the layer of brownie batter. This layers in delicious flavor.

  4. Spread the Cookie Dough: Carefully spread the chocolate chip cookie dough over the Oreos, making sure to cover them completely.

  5. Top with Brownies: Pour the remaining brownie batter on top of the cookie dough layer, smoothing it out.

  6. Add Chocolate Chips: If you want an extra touch, sprinkle chocolate chips on the top for added richness.

  7. Bake: Bake according to the brownie mix package instructions,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out mostly clean.

  8. Cool and Cut: Allow the baking dish to cool before cutting it into squares for serving.

Serving and Storage Tips

To serve Oreo Brownie Cookie Bars, place them on a nice serving platter and consider adding a scoop of vanilla ice cream on the side for an extra treat. To store, keep the bars in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. You can also refrigerate them to prolong their freshness.

Helpful Notes

  • Mix it Up: Feel free to experiment with different cookie dough flavors. You could use peanut butter cookie dough for a twist!
  • Lower Fat Option: Substitute Greek yogurt for some of the oil in the brownie mix for a lighter version.
  • Freezing: These bars freeze well. Cut and wrap them individually before placing them in a freezer-safe bag. They can be enjoyed later for a quick treat!

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use a different brand of brownie mix?

Absolutely! Any brand or even homemade brownie mix will work just fine for this recipe.

How do I make this gluten-free?

You can use gluten-free brownie mix and ensure that your cookie dough is also gluten-free.

Can I prepare this ahead of time?

Yes! You can make these bars a day in advance. Just store them properly and let them sit at room temperature for a bit before serving.
